[improve] [client] Merge lookup requests for the same topic (#21232)
Motivation: Multiple consumers and producers can be maintained by the same
Pulsar Client. In some cases, multiple consumers or producers might attempt to
connect to the same topic. To optimize the process, it is recommended to
perform the topic lookup only once for each topic.
Modifications:
- Merge lookup requests for the same topic.
- Merge get partitioned metadata request for the same partitioned topic.
